Types of grill pan 3 in 1

A grill pan 3 in 1 is a cooking pan that combines three functions into one pan, typically including grilling, frying, and stewing. They come in different types, such as cast iron, non-stick, and stainless steel.

  • Cast iron grill pan 3 in 1:

    These grill pans are made from cast iron, which retains heat well and is suitable for grilling.

    Advantage:

    They are suitable for all heat sources, including induction, and can be used in the oven.

    Non-stick grill pans 3 in 1:

    These grill pans have a non-stick coating that makes cooking and cleaning easier.

    Advantage:

    They are suitable for low-fat cooking and apply to all heat sources.

    Stainless steel grill pan 3 in 1:

    They are durable and provide even heat distribution.

    Advantage:

    They are dishwasher safe and compatible with all heat sources.

Design of grill pan 3 in 1

  • Material

    A 3-in-1 grill pan is usually made from cast iron, stainless steel, or heavy-duty aluminum materials. These materials are durable and retain heat effectively. The cast iron material is suitable for all stovetops, including induction, and can be used in the oven. The stainless steel material is rust-resistant and suitable for all stovetops. The heavy-duty aluminum material has a non-stick interior and exterior and is free of PFOA.

  • Shape and Size

    The shape of the grill pan is rectangular so that it can fit well on the stove and in the oven. The size varies depending on the number of people one intends to cook for. Most grill pans are large enough to prepare meals for an entire family at once.

  • Handle

    The handle of the 3-in-1 grill pan is heat resistant and has a firm grip to prevent accidental drops. Some handles are foldable, while others are detachable.

  • Surface

    The cooking surface of the grill pan has ridges that create grill marks on the food and allow excess oil or liquid to drain away. Some grill pans have a flat surface on one side and a griddle surface on the other side.

  • Interchangeable Components

    With the multiple components of the 3-in-1 grill pan, one can switch between the grill pan, skillet, and shabu shabu pot.

  • Base

    The base of the grill pan is designed to distribute heat evenly, ensuring that the food is well-cooked. Some bases are induction-compatible.

How to choose a 3-in-1 grill pan

  • Material

    3-in-1 grill pans are made from cast iron, stainless steel, or non-stick materials. Cast iron provides excellent heat retention; stainless steel is durable and versatile, and non-stick surfaces require less oil for cooking.

  • Compatibility with Heat Sources

    Check what heat sources the pan works with. Most grill pans work on gas, electric, and induction cooktops, but some may also be used in the oven or on outdoor grills.

  • Size and Storage

    Consider how much cooking space is available. Grill pans are usually 10–14 inches wide, but checking the storage space is essential since some grill pans can be folded or disassembled to occupy less space.

  • Ease of Use

    Look for features like comfortable handles, ease of switching between different cooking surfaces, and the overall weight of the pan.

  • Durability and Build Quality

    Select a grill pan that is well-constructed and robust enough to withstand regular use. Cast iron or heavy gauge materials are generally more durable.

  • Versatility

    3-in-1 functionality allows grilling, frying, and even making stews in one pot, thus saving space and time.

  • Brand and Reviews

    Choose reputable brands and read user reviews to learn the performance and durability of the grill pan.

  • Price

    Set a budget and find a grill pan that meets the needs without compromising quality.

  • Special Features

    Look for any additional features, such as removable handles, compatibility with multiple heat sources, and warranty coverage.
